Jollibee Starmall Lawa-An 1, Talisay City

Cebu City,
Jollibee Starmall Lawa-An 1, Talisay City Jollibee Starmall Lawa-An 1, Talisay City is one of the popular Local Business located in ,Cebu City listed under Local business in Cebu City , Residence in Cebu City , Restaurant in Cebu City ,

Contact Details & Working Hours

Map of Jollibee Starmall Lawa-An 1, Talisay City